Wear Intensity of an Epoxy Compound in a Loose Abrasive Environment under Negligible Shock Actions

Abstract The linear dependence of abrasive wear under negligible shock actions as a function of the testing time has been established. The change of the wear intensity over time corresponds to the effect of the self-organization of wear.
